1. WHEN TO USE THIS UTILITY
===========================
This utility is only intended for Nefinity 3500 Servers, installing or loading
NT 4.0 on a SCSI hardfile that is running off of the on board 7895, experiencing
one of two possible hang conditions:
        1.Scenario #1 Server Guide Install:
        The installation will successfully assing partitions, load appropriate
        files and then request a reboot.  After the reboot, at the blue
        screen, there is no activity.  The system is hung at this time.

        2. Scenario #2 Diskette Install:
        After following the appropriate procedure that allows the proper
        installation of the Adaptec SCSI driver from the manufacture's diskette,
        the system hangs during the SCSI driver initialization, i.e. the system
        does not successfully load the driver.

2. DIRECTIONS ON HOW TO USE THIS UTILITY
========================================
1. Boot to this diskette
2. At DOS prompt type "zero"
3. When Prompted to choose port, enter "0" for the appropriate port
4. After "A" prompt returns to screen, remove diskette  and reboot system
